There is hereby created an advisory committee which shall be known as
the "Township of Franklin Historical Advisory Committee," hereinafter called
the "Advisory Committee."
The Township Committee shall designate a member of the Advisory Committee as Chairman thereof, who shall serve for a term of one year. At the first meeting of the Advisory Committee, its members shall elect from among themselves the officers of the Advisory Committee and shall establish rules and procedures for its members. It shall keep accurate records of its meetings and activities and shall file an annual report as provided in §
58-5 of this chapter.
The powers and duties of the Advisory Committee shall be to:
A. Acquire and preserve documents, records and relics of
the Township of Franklin and whatever may relate to the history of the State
of New Jersey and the United States.
B. Encourage the protection and preservation of the historical
landmarks and points of interest within the Township of Franklin.
C. Encourage historical and genealogical research and publication
of its results.
D. Make all information and acquisitions of the Advisory
Committee available to the public.
E. Advise the Township Committee on matters affecting the
historical landmarks and points of interest.
F. Maintain an up-to-date inventory or index of all historical
documents, records, relics, landmarks and points of interest within the Township
of Franklin.
G. Seek to coordinate, assist and unify the efforts of private
groups, institutions and individuals within the Township of Franklin in accord
with the purposes of this chapter.
H. Maintain liaison and communications with public and private
agencies and organizations of local, state and national scope whose programs
and activities have an impact on the protection and preservation of the historical
points of interest or who can be of assistance to the Advisory Committee.
I. Carry out other such duties as may be assigned from time
to time by the Township Committee.
The Advisory Committee shall submit an annual report to the Township
Committee not later than the first day of December of each year covering the
activities and work of the Advisory Committee and from time to time shall
submit such reports and recommendations as may be necessary to fulfill the
purposes of this chapter.
The members of the Advisory Committee, including ex officio members,
shall receive no compensation for their services as members thereof but may
be reimbursed for reasonable and necessary appropriations made available therefor,
but only upon request to and approval by the Township Committee.
This chapter shall be deemed an exercise of the powers of the Township
of Franklin to protect and preserve historical documents, records, relics,
landmarks and points of interest located within the Township of Franklin,
and this chapter is not intended and shall not be deemed to impair the powers
of the Township Committee, Planning Board, Zoning Board of Adjustment or any
other public corporation.
